Understanding the Fundamentals of Physics-Based Game Worlds
To create stable physics-based game worlds, developers need to have a solid grasp of the underlying principles of physics, mathematics, and computer science. The Advanced Certificate program covers the fundamentals of physics engines, collision detection, and response, as well as the mathematics behind 3D graphics and simulation. Students learn how to apply these concepts to real-world scenarios, using industry-standard tools and software such as Unity and Unreal Engine. By mastering these fundamentals, developers can create game worlds that are not only visually stunning but also physically accurate and engaging.
Best Practices for Building Stable Physics-Based Game Worlds
Building stable physics-based game worlds requires a deep understanding of the complex interactions between objects, environments, and players. The Advanced Certificate program teaches students best practices for designing and optimizing physics-based systems, including techniques for reducing computational complexity, improving performance, and ensuring stability. Students also learn how to use debugging tools and techniques to identify and fix issues, ensuring that their game worlds are robust and reliable. By following these best practices, developers can create game worlds that are not only stable but also highly immersive and engaging.
